  • Ensuring High Pressure Membrane Performance for the Removal of EDCs, Pharmaceuticals, and Personal Care Products from Potable Supplies
  • Conference Proceeding by American Water Works Association, 11/01/2009

This powerpoint presentation begins by providing a brief overview of the growth of the nanofiltration (NF)/reverse osmosis (RO) industry. Several factors are presented that are impacting rejection: compound characteristics; membrane characteristics; and, system design characteristics. Predicting qualitative rejection categories is presented, along with a list of compounds detected in RO permeates inpilot-scale or full-scale testing; RO performance for single stage; RO performance impacted by staging; RO performance further impacted bybreaching of staged system; impact of chlorine damaged element onconductivity probing measurements; impact of breaching on compounddetection; hypothesized factors contributing towardcompound passage; and, knowledge gaps and industry needs. Includes tables, figures.
